Tip#1: SIMPLICITY

The key to writing better is ‘SIMPLICITY’. William Zinsser in his book ‘On writing Well’, which is considered as a classic guide for anyone who’s new to writing say that make your sentences simpler and simpler until you feel that the it cannot be simplified further.

Be very clear about what you want to convey and express to your audience. If you’re clear yourself then and then only you’ll be able to express the thought or idea simply.

Tip#2: BE SPECIFIC

In the free pdf by ship30for30, a load of weight is given to specificity. Being specific will give you a strong, engaged audience base. If you write about a more general topic, you’ll get more audience, more reach but if you want to build a loyal audience, target a specific niche.
